- The HSE Counsel will offer legal advice on various environmental and regulatory matters related to the company's strategic business units across different countries where the company operates.
- This involves interpreting laws like the Clean Air Act, Clean Water Act, Resource Conservation and Recovery Act, the Comprehensive Environmental Response Compensation and Liability Act, OSHA, and others.
- Additionally, they will collaborate with HSE corporate and business unit teams to identify and minimize potential legal risks.
- eProviding legal support to multiple functions including Finance, Procurement, EH&S, Global Trade Compliance, Product Stewardship, Customer Service, and IT
- Offering legal support on corporate organizational, antitrust, commercial, financing, real estate and facilities, and transactional matters, including mergers & acquisitions and corporate restructuring
